Output d40be265a21879f8d25d444f89ae8020a28463f9e78469300f235bb3f121d54e:0

value
128591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c16848c5d305556b55901e7337d044c78adabea OP_EQUAL
address
3D18gtivotsBTVY37gw7bNkVMZv8QimzhD
transaction
d40be265a21879f8d25d444f89ae8020a28463f9e78469300f235bb3f121d54e
spent
true